Output e0cc16656c68b6c8a6ec2ae358d684553cf53376d5b1313cd25b066a88b5d005:21

value
5271
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c6527ed3940bcd0cf415295bfb7424de16cf8c220b5664bf2492660876646206
address
bc1pcef8a5u5p0xseaq499dlkapymctvlrpzpdtxf0eyjfnqsanyvgrq7sm33q
transaction
e0cc16656c68b6c8a6ec2ae358d684553cf53376d5b1313cd25b066a88b5d005
spent
true